Can you explain this vulnerability to me?
This vulnerability is a reflected cross-site scripting (XSS) issue in Comodo Dome Firewall version 2.7.0. It occurs because the firewall improperly handles input submitted to the FWADDRESSES parameter. Attackers can send specially crafted POST requests to the /korugan/fwgroups endpoint containing malicious scripts. When these scripts are executed in users' browsers, attackers can run arbitrary JavaScript code.
How can this vulnerability impact me? :
The vulnerability allows attackers to execute arbitrary JavaScript in the browsers of users interacting with the affected firewall. This can lead to the theft of session data, potentially allowing attackers to hijack user sessions or perform unauthorized actions on behalf of the user.
